Public bug reported:
The following program (compile with gcc -g -Wall test-gtk.c -o test-gtk
`pkg-config --cflags --libs gtk+-3.0`):
#include <gtk/gtk.h>
int main (int argc, char **argv)
{
gtk_init (&argc, &argv);
GtkWidget *w = gtk_window_new (GTK_WINDOW_TOPLEVEL);
gtk_widget_show (w);
GtkWidget *l = gtk_label_new ("M");
gtk_widget_show (l);
gtk_container_add (GTK_CONTAINER (w), l);
gtk_main ();
return 0;
}
Causes XMir to crash. Removing the label causes it to run fine.
